The Philippines Endovascular Aneurysm Repair Market is witnessing growth driven by increasing awareness about minimally invasive procedures. Endovascular aneurysm repair is preferred over traditional open surgery due to its lower risks, quicker recovery time, and less post-operative complications. The market is primarily driven by the rising prevalence of cardiovascular diseases and aortic aneurysms in the country. Key market players are focusing on introducing advanced technologies and devices to improve treatment outcomes and patient safety. Government initiatives to enhance healthcare infrastructure and increase access to advanced medical treatments are also contributing to market growth. However, challenges such as high treatment costs and limited availability of skilled healthcare professionals may hinder market expansion in the Philippines.

In the Philippines Endovascular Aneurysm Repair market, several challenges are faced. These include limited awareness among the general population about aneurysms and available treatment options, leading to delayed diagnosis and treatment. Additionally, the high cost associated with endovascular aneurysm repair procedures can be a significant barrier for many patients, especially in a country where healthcare access and insurance coverage may be limited. Furthermore, there may be a shortage of skilled healthcare professionals trained in performing endovascular procedures, impacting the availability and quality of care provided to patients with aneurysms. Overcoming these challenges will require efforts to increase public education, improve affordability of treatments, and enhance training programs for healthcare providers in the Philippines.
